Senior Data Engineer
KAYAK
KAYAK, part of Booking Holdings (NASDAQ: BKNG), is the world's leading travel search engine. With billions of queries across our platforms, we help people find their perfect flight, stay, rental car and vacation package. We're also transforming business travel with a new corporate travel solution, KAYAK for Business.
As an employee of KAYAK, you will be part of a travel company that operates a portfolio of global metasearch brands including momondo, Cheapflights and HotelsCombined, among others. From start-up to industry leader, innovation is at our core and every employee has an opportunity to make their mark. Our focus is on building the best travel search engine to make it easier for everyone to experience the world.
We are looking for a Senior Data Engineer to join our Business Intelligence team.
Our team builds and operates the data backbone that serves as the single source of truth for the organization. We manage KAYAK’s business-critical reporting to support billing and provide the foundation for company-wide reporting and analytics.
If you want to build the systems that define how the business measures success, we’d love to hear from you.
This role will be required to work from our Concord, MA office 3 days per week.
IN THIS ROLE, YOU WILL:
- Architect for scale: Develop and monitor robust data pipelines using Python, SQL, and Rundeck/Airflow that handle large-scale data volumes with high reliability.
- Optimize performance: Design performant data models and optimize complex SQL queries for high-scale environments.
- Ensure data reliability: build automated checks and alerts to catch errors early so financial and operational reports remain accurate.
- Increase data access: automate repetitive tasks and build self-service tools to make data easier to use across teams.
- Drive engineering excellence: experiment with and leverage AI-assisted coding tools to accelerate development cycles and enhance code quality.
- Work with partners across th...
Share this job: